What really saves time: an established network of service providers
One of the main challenges of planning a wedding in just a few months is finding vendors who are available.
Photographers, florists, caterers, videographers, musicians: finding the right professionals on short notice can quickly become a challenge.
This is exactly where the support of a wedding planner really comes into its own.
Thanks to a network built up over the years, it is now possible to quickly identify the partners best suited to the project and check their availability without having to go back and forth multiple times.
This saves the couple weeks of searching and allows them to work directly with professionals who have been selected for the quality of their work and their reliability.

What does planning a wedding in Provence in 90 days look like?
First month: laying the groundwork
The first few weeks are devoted to strategic decisions:
- budget definition;
- choice of location;
- reservation of essential service providers;
- creating the wedding's visual identity.
This is the phase that sets the tone for the entire project.
Month 2: Customization
Once the main partners have been confirmed, the focus shifts to the guest experience:
- decoration;
- flowers;
- ceremony;
- stationery;
- accommodations;
- activities.
The project is gradually taking shape.
Third month: final adjustments
The past few weeks have allowed us to finalize:
- the schedule for the day;
- guest confirmations;
- the seating chart;
- coordination of service providers;
- all logistical aspects.
At this stage, the goal is simple: to let the bride and groom fully enjoy the days leading up to their wedding.
